MySQL數據庫是互聯網開發中最常用的數據庫之一,其設計和管理需要使用專業的數據庫設計工具。MySQL數據庫設計工具可以幫助開發人員快速、準確地設計數據庫表結構,提高開發效率。本文將介紹幾種常見的MySQL數據庫設計工具。
Mysql Workbench是MySQL官方推薦的免費開源數據庫設計工具,它支持多種平臺,包括 Windows、Linux 和 Mac OS X。Mysql Workbench 可以讓開發人員創建、編輯和管理數據庫,它提供了實用的數據建模、SQL開發、和服務器配置管理等功能。
CREATE TABLE `user` ( `id` int(11) NOT NULL AUTO_INCREMENT, `name` varchar(50) NOT NULL, `age` int(3) DEFAULT NULL, `gender` varchar(10) DEFAULT NULL, PRIMARY KEY (`id`) ) ENGINE=InnoDB DEFAULT CHARSET=utf8;
Navicat是一款功能強大的MySQL數據庫管理工具,它支持多種平臺,包括 Windows、Mac 和 Linux 等操作系統。Navicat具有強大的數據導入、導出功能以及數據備份、復制、同步等功能。除了 MySQL 之外,還支持 Oracle、PostgreSQL、SQLite、MariaDB等多種數據庫的管理。
SELECT user.id,user.name,orders.id FROM user,orders WHERE user.id = orders.userid ORDER BY user.id, orders.id;
DbSchema是一款全平臺數據庫設計工具,它支持多種數據庫類型,包括:MySQL、Oracle、DB2、SQL Server、PostgreSQL等。它提供了數據建模、數據可視化、和SQL查詢等功能,而且支持多語言和跨平臺。
綜上所述,MySQL 數據庫設計工具能夠幫助開發人員更快、更準確地設計數據庫表結構,并提高開發效率。以上介紹的幾款MySQL數據庫設計工具,可根據開發人員的需求和操作系統選擇合適的工具。